Role: SAP/BW Data Warehouse Analyst. Location: Harlow, Essex. Role Type: Hybrid (Remote/Hybrid working with occasional travel to main UK sites, Glenrothes and Harlow).
Raytheon UK has an opportunity for an experienced IT professional to support ERP BW development. The function sits within the Digital Technology team and is responsible for the delivery and support of application solutions to all UK based divisions to enable operational business delivery. This role involves supporting and maintaining the full application life cycle, handling day-to-day operations, and implementing new business requirements / configuration changes and new stand-ups, while integrating data between applications. The successful candidate will deliver BW data warehouse and reporting solutions and contribute to understanding new business requirements, testing, and integration with other applications.
Responsibilities
- Collaborate with functional/business teams to deliver systems that meet functional and business requirements.
- Work with staff and users to ensure changes are delivered in a timely and effective manner.
- Interface with user communities on bug fixes, requests for service, and approved changes to current systems and new applications.
- Ensure ongoing availability of Raytheon systems; aim for improved system productivity.
- Provide system support within published service levels-respond to break fixes and perform preventative maintenance.
- Maintain the integrity, availability, and security of information and systems.
- Conduct business analysis and requirements capture; perform systems analysis, programming, testing, data analysis and design.
- Support system implementation including training, user assistance, and problem resolution.
- Develop documentation for technologists and users; respond to break fixes and perform preventive maintenance.
- Analyze, design, code, test, implement, document, and support development and enhancements to RSL applications and interfaces.
- Monitor Helpdesk and Change Control systems; update configuration/change management tools and reflect changes in System Maps.
- Engage with vendors to deliver requirements and resolve issues; occasional visits to other RSL sites or partner organisations may be required.
Qualifications
- Educated to degree level or equivalent, with strong SAP Business Warehouse (BW) and ABAP programming experience.
- Experience with SAP NetWeaver BW Dataflows (3.x & 7.x), SAP Business Explorer Toolset (including Query Designer and Web Analyser).
- General knowledge of a broad range of IT technologies; familiarity with formal systems delivery methodologies.
- Experience delivering and supporting business-critical application packages within large organisations.
Nice to have
- Knowledge and operational experience in manufacturing or defence industries.
- Experience with CPS job scheduler (SAP Business Process Automation by Redwood).
- Strong understanding of SAP BW concepts including Dataflows (3.x & 7.x), InfoObjects, Datasources, DSOs, Cubes, and Multiproviders.
- Ability to administer Process Chains and resolve data loading issues.
- Experience with BEx Query Designer, Analyzer, and Web Application Designer.
- Support ad-hoc end-user requests and investigate data anomalies or unexpected query results.
- Regular monitoring of BW batch activity and participation in service status & alerting framework.
